In their rambles through the Netherlands, somewhere in the Province of Drenthe, the two rascals Robert and Bertrand are witness to a brutal robbery. A coach is raided by a threesome of scoundrels. They rescue the two occupants, a nice young man called Hans and his future bride Lene. Lene's
father, the farmer Barends, is dead set against their marriage because of
Hans' 'inferior' job, being 'only' an itinerant lanternist. Lena however is
very proud of her Hans and loves him very much. Hans
tells enthusiastically about the history of the magic lantern and then
shows a beautiful series of lantern slides about the legend of the two
giants
Ellert and Brammert, who once lived in this part of the country. While
the two friends continue their travels, farmer Barends succeeds in abducting his
daughter from the arms of Hans, who is beaten insensible by his servants and
is admitted to hospital. The two rascals ask for accommodation at the farm
in exchange for keeping it a secret from the police. | |

During a
magic lantern show the vagabonds search for the kidnapped daughter and hand
her a letter from Hans. Lena seizes the opportunity to escape from the house
and shortly thereafter a mysterious woman sets the farm on fire. Barends
suspects one of his tenants of this deed, for a short time ago he chased the
man and his family away from his yard because the poor man was not able to
pay his debts, and now he sends his servants to his
miserable turf hut to punish him. Fortunately Robert en Bertrand come to the
rescue. When they look at the lantern slides meticulously afterwards, they
discover the identity of the mysterious woman. Soon thereafter they also
solve the secret that farmer Barends and his wife Wubbechien had born for so many
years. At the end of the story Barends feels sorry and gives his daughter
permission to marry her fiancé. The happy couple move in at the farm and
Robert and Bertrand say goodbye, setting off for new adventures. |

| ROBERT EN BERTRAND De Toverlantaarn
(the magic lantern) is a story
by Willy Vandersteen. Published by Standaard Uitgeverij, Antwerpen-Amsterdam. |
